Sound baths are an immersive sound experience, using a variety of instruments including a gong, crystal singing bowls and other gentle sounds, to relax the mind and body, supporting you to feel rested and relaxed. You do not need to do anything during the experience, simply receive the healing energy of the sounds. Please bring a yoga mat or something similar to lie down on, blankets and pillows, and anything else you need to be comfortable. Sound baths are a chance for you to intentionally slow down, step away from the busyness of life and support your well-being. I will start with a short guided meditation to help ground you and arrive in the space, and then I will create the soundscape for you. At the end of the practice, there will be time for you to gently wake up, pick an oracle card, and allow the experience to integrate.
Please note that sound baths are not suitable during pregnancy, for those with epilepsy, pacemakers or serious heart conditions due to the vibrations produced from the bowls.
